Session 10: Setting Sail Report

General Summary

The start of the session found the Menagerie standing before the thankful villagers of Donborough, accepting accolades for ridding the town of a great, centuries-old evil. Osrick Riverhands pulled Droknar aside to ask questions about his magical abilities, while the party was approached by Nangan the apothecary. Nangan provided the Menagerie with more context on Shoku and the ratlings they had encountered in Timberwall, as well as more insight into their society. He advised the party against using the Sending Stones to contact Shoku, unless they were certain it was the correct course of action.   Following the meeting, the Menagerie made their way to the harbor where they encountered the bronze dragonborn Sabym Banil, the captain of the Triton's Lance. She proceeded to introduce the party to the rest of the crew and went over the rules for traveling on her ship. She gave the party a few hours to get their affairs in order before the ship was to set sail.   Skreech and Rinrin collected their studded leather from Xara Lotore and spent some time in the marketplace, where Rinrin contracted the hobgoblin tailor Noki to prepare for her some Shiftweave Clothing. Droknar bought some ammunition from Rigak and visited Nangan to pick up a few healing potions, while Dacha obtained a set of bedrolls from Sheriff Morro.   Dacha took some time to speak with one of the mercenaries who had been travelling with Beradin Glimdrak, an elf named Uridan. The elf mentioned that the mercenaries had brought all their supplies from Donborough, except for their water, which they filled from local water sources around Dacha's home village. Both of them guessed that Beradin didn't fall ill because of his dwarven heritage. As the elf ended the conversation with a warning about traveling on the high seas, Dacha made a point to visit the Temple of the Wavemother to speak with Nasse before they departed. There he found Nasse wearing the Diadem of Thar Ashaela as she attempted to commune with her deity and decided to sit down and practice the rites with her. Awaking from her trance, the priestess wished Dacha safe travels but warned him that, since they had left Timberwall, she had been encountering a malevolent presence whenever she communed with the Wavemother.   Their business in Donborough accomplished, the Menagerie returned to the Triton's Lance. Nightwind, the Corvidkin merchant who had taken a liking to Dacha, was there; she had reconsidered her plans and decided to return to Mekkisir, a decision at least partially influenced by meeting Dacha. During the first afternoon on the ocean, the party got to know the crew of the Triton's Lance a bit better. Droknar approached the ship's Bosun, a dwarf named Hunson Marblearm, following up on a comment from the captain about how he could drink her under the table. Their conversation led to the crew declaring a drinking contest between all of the Menagerie except Dacha. It seemed to be a close contest between Droknar, Rinrin, Hunson, and the ship's surgeon, Arlin, until a slight slip-up from Rinrin revealed she had been using magic to sneak her drinks, leaving the ship's surgeon the winner.   That evening, Skreech was visited again by the goddess Mekhane; this time, she seemed pleased with him. She congratulated him for using his gifts to bring another follower into her flock and when he awoke, he found for the first time since he'd started having visions of her, his affliction had not progressed.   On the second day, the Menagerie noticed a pirate ship in the distance and alerted the captain. She decided to steer their vessel closer to land, both to avoid the Pale Corsairs as well as visit a restaurant known as the Scuttled Hut. There the party enjoyed some of the better food they'd had in several weeks, and also encountered Silvie, the missing member of the group of Quilport Journeymen who the party had encountered in Timberwall. Rinrin managed to trick Silvie into approaching their table, at which point Droknar and Dacha pulled the woman outside to interrogate her. She revealed that she was planning to head to Mekkisir to report to Deleth Yorkiras, the leader of the Company, who was in the city for negotiations with their leader. Droknar convinced Silvie to go into hiding, with Dacha providing the woman the location of his village where she could hide out.   The lunch is cut short by a message from the ship; as the crew returns they find a Pale Corsairs ship fast approaching their vessel. The Menagerie man the battle stations as the Triton's Lance raised her sails to speed away. The two ships exchanged fire, with a well-placed shot from Skreech and his golem compatriots dealing severe enough damage to the corsair vessel that the pirates were forced to retreat. In the evening, Dacha approached Noki and asked the hobgoblin if he could stitch together the two bedrolls to make a single, large bedroll, which the hobgoblin agreed to do.   The following day saw storms approaching from the south, so the ship diverted toward an area where several rocky outcroppings rose from the waters. The ship was soon attacked by harpies but between the Menagerie and the crew, the matriarch of the harpies was slain and the surviving monsters fled for their lives, leaving the Menagerie to continue their journey to Mekkisir.
